blue matrix

Parsing in Go, showing in Wails

It's an achievement. I was stuck for several days, daunted by the prospect of connecting Pigeon, which is a PEG parser generator for Go, to Wails which is my target platform.

Well I succeeded!

Screen capture of a successful parsing

This would be probably nothing to anyone used to working with Go, but I'm completely new to this. Of course I used an example grammar from the Pigeon repo, a simple math expression one, but the next step is to create & flesh out a real parser for Hup. Just being able to generate the parser and to access it, is already a huge step forward for me!

Yeah, 3 × 5 = 15... it's show time 🤩